D-Lux 4 - New Functions Firmware Update 2.2

The firmware update for the Leica D-LUX 4 camera adds several new functions and customization options. Key additions include the ability to take photos with a 1:1 aspect ratio, use white balance bracketing, increase exposure compensation to +/-3 EV, customize the position of guide lines, resume zoom and manual focus positions after turning the camera off, add a high dynamic scene mode, include the user's name in images, and view highlights during playback. The update also modifies features like red-eye removal and the items included in custom settings.

Recording function with an aspect ratio of 1:1 has been added.


[1:1 ASPECT] has been added to [REC] menu.
You can take pictures with an aspect ratio of 1:1 (square aspect ratio) to match the printing
or playback method.
1 Select [1:1 ASPECT] on the [REC] menu and then press 1.

2 Press 3/4 to select [ON] and then press [MENU/SET].


• It can be set regardless of the position of the aspect ratio selector switch.
3 Press [MENU/SET] to close the menu.
• You can also press the shutter button halfway to close the menu.

Note
• This cannot be used in Snapshot mode or motion picture mode.
• To cancel the setting, set the [1:1 ASPECT] to [OFF], or switch the aspect ratio selector switch.
It will be set to the aspect ratio of the position of the aspect ratio selector switch.
• Settings for the number of recording pixels will be as follows:
(7.5M) [2736k2736 pixels], (5.5M ) [2304k2304 pixels],
(3.5M ) [1920k1920 pixels], (2.5M ) [1536k1536 pixels]
• Picture size will be set to 2.5M (1536k1536 pixels) in the following scene modes. [QUALITY] is
automatically fixed to [›]:
– [HIGH SENS.]/[HI-SPEED BURST]/[FLASH BURST]/[PIN HOLE]/[FILM GRAIN]
• Aspect ratio for the following functions will also be set to [1:1]:
– RAW recording/AF area selection/[MULTI EXPO.]/[GUIDE LINE]/[MF ASSIST]
• [1:1 ASPECT] has been added to the [Fn BUTTON SET] of the [SETUP] menu.
• When the [1:1 ASPECT] is set to [ON], pictures with an aspect ratio of [1:1] can also be taken
with the [MULTI ASPECT] recording.
It will automatically take 4 pictures with aspect ratios of [4:3]/[3:2]/[16:9]/[1:1] when the shutter
button is pressed. Combinations of the picture size will be as follows:

[4:3] > [3:2] > [16:9] > [1:1]


10M 9.5M 9M 7.5M
7M 6.5M 6M 5.5M
5M 4.5M 4.5M 3.5M
3M 3M 2.5M 2.5M
• If you set [TEXT STAMP] for a picture with a picture size larger than (1:1), the picture size
will become smaller as shown below.
/ / > (1:1)
• Pictures with an aspect ratio of [1:1] can also be resized when [RESIZE] is set.
• Aspect ratio can be converted to [1:1] as well when the [ASPECT CONV.] is set.

A white balance (WB) bracket function has been added.


Bracket setting is performed based on the adjustment values for the white balance fine
adjustment, and 3 pictures with different colours are automatically recorded when the
shutter button is pressed once.

1 Select [WHITE BALANCE] on the [REC] menu and then press 1.


2 Press 3/4 to select the item and then press 1.
• Press 1 again if [ 1 ], [ 2 ] or [ ] is selected.
• The white balance fine adjustment screen is displayed.
3 Press [DISPLAY] to switch to the white balance bracket
setting screen.
• It will return to the white balance fine adjustment screen when
the [DISPLAY] is pressed again.

4 Press 3/4/2/1 to set the bracket setting.


3/4: Vertical (Gi to Mj)
2/1: Horizontal (A to B)
• Position of the bracket can be set only for one direction, in either the horizontal direction or
vertical direction.
5 Press [MENU/SET].

Note
•[ ] A is displayed in the LCD monitor when it is set.
• Position of the bracket cannot be set exceeding the limit of the white
balance fine adjustment (limit value).
• When the white balance fine adjustment is performed after the setting
of the bracket, pictures will be taken with a bracket with the changed
adjustment value as the centre value.
• You will only hear the shutter sound once. A
• The white balance bracket setting is cancelled when the power has
been turned off.
• White balance bracket will not work when the quality is set to [ ], [ ], or [ ].
• This cannot be used in Snapshot mode or motion picture mode.
• This cannot be used in the scene modes that cannot perform white balance fine adjustment.
• The following functions cannot be used simultaneously:
– [AUTO BRACKET]/[MULTI ASPECT]/[BURST SHOOTING]/[MULTI FILM]/[MULTI EXPO.]/
[AUDIO REC.]

[LENS RESUME] has been added to the [SETUP] menu.


It is possible to memorise the zoom position and the MF (manual focus) position when the
power is switched [OFF].

[ZOOM RESUME]: [OFF]/[ON]


It will automatically return to the zoom position when the power
was switched [OFF], next time you turn the power [ON].
[MF RESUME]: [OFF]/[ON]
It will memorise the MF position set with the manual focus. It will
[LENS RESUME] resume the memorised manual focus position when you return to
manual focus recording.
MF position will be memorised in the following cases:
– Turning the camera off
– When the focus selector switch is switched to anything but [MF]
– When switched to playback mode
• Zoom position will be set all the way to wide when the [ZOOM RESUME] is set to [OFF].
• MF position will be set to ¶ (infinity) when the [MF RESUME] is set to [OFF].
• Depending on the recording conditions, the memorised MF positions and resumed MF
positions might be different.

[HIGH DYNAMIC] has been added to scene mode.


You can use this mode to easily record pictures in which bright and dark regions of the
scene are expressed with suitable brightness when looking into the sun, at night, or in
similar circumstances.

[HIGH DYNAMIC]
∫ Setting the effect
1 Press 3/4 to select the effect to use, and then press [MENU/SET].
• It can be set from the quick menu.
[ ]: Natural colour effect
[ ]: Eye-catching effect which emphasises contrast and colour
[ ]: Black and white effect
2 Take pictures.

Note
• ISO sensitivity is fixed to [ISO400].
• RAW pictures cannot be recorded.
• Compensation effect may not be achieved depending on the conditions.
• The shutter may remain closed (max. about 8 sec.) after taking the picture because of signal
processing. This is not a malfunction.
• The focus range is 1 cm (0.04 feet) (Wide)/30 cm (0.99 feet) (Tele) to ¶.
• Noise on the LCD monitor may show up more than in normal recording conditions due to
compensation of the shadowy area, making it brighter.
• Only [‹] and [Œ] for flash can be set.
• You cannot use Burst Mode and [ ] in [AF MODE].

It is now possible to record the user’s name in the picture.


[USER’S NAME REC] has been added to the [SETUP] menu.
User’s name can be recorded in the picture while taking the picture. The user’s name
recorded in the picture can be confirmed by using software like Capture One or Adobe
Photoshop Lightroom.
[OFF]: It will not record the user’s name.
[ON]: It will record the user’s name.
[SET]: It will register (change) the user’s name.
To register (change) the user’s name
1 Press 3/4/2/1 to select text and
then press [MENU/SET] to register.
• Characters that can be entered are
/ (Roman alphabet) and &/1
(symbols/numbers). Maximum number
[USER’S NAME REC] of characters that can be entered is 64
characters.
• Press [DISPLAY] to switch the input characters.
• Operate the zoom lever to move the position of the input cursor.
• To enter a blank, move the cursor to [SPACE] or to delete an
entered character, move the cursor to [DELETE], and press
[MENU/SET].
• To stop editing at any time during text entry, press [‚].
2 Press 3/4/2/1 to move the cursor to [EXIT] and then
press [MENU/SET] to end text input.
• User’s name cannot be recorded in RAW pictures.
• User’s name cannot be recorded in pictures already taken.
• Recorded user’s names cannot be confirmed using the camera.

[MENU RESUME] has been added to the [SETUP] menu.


The last operated menu position is saved even if the camera is turned off.
[MENU RESUME] [OFF]/[ON]

It is now possible to display the highlights in playback mode.


Area with a whiteout condition is displayed by flashing in black and white in playback
mode as well when [HIGHLIGHT] in the [SETUP] menu is set to [ON].
Note
• This will not work in playback zoom, dual play, slide show, motion picture playback, still picture
playback with audio, calendar search, and multi playback.

Digital red-eye removal has been modified.


[RED-EYE REMOVAL] has been added to the [REC] menu.
Setting for the [RED-EYE REMOVAL] can be set to [ON]/[OFF] depending on your
preference.
1 Select [RED-EYE REMOVAL] on the [REC] menu and then press 1.
2 Press 3/4 to select [ON] and then press [MENU/SET].
• [ ] is displayed in the red-eye reduction icon in the flash setting.
3 Set the flash to [ ], [ ], or [ ].
• When you take a picture with a flash and face detection with [š] set in [AF MODE], the picture data
will be corrected by automatically detecting the red-eye in the recognised face.
Note
• It may not be able to correct the red-eye depending on the recording conditions.
• [RED-EYE REMOVAL] will be set to [ON] in Snapshot mode.
• Digital red-eye removal will not function when this is set to [OFF].
